What problem does it solve?

When user motivation dips or onboarding feels flat, flows fail to sustain engagement. This Skill applies UX laws to diagnose drop-offs and propose targeted improvements.

Core Features & Use Cases

  • Peak-End Rule: Create a memorable peak and a strong ending.
  • Goal-Gradient Effect: Show visible progress to boost motivation.
  • Zeigarnik Effect: Use unfinished states to encourage return visits.
  • Flow Design Checklist: Map stages and apply law-based fixes.

What is the Peak-End Rule and how does it improve user retention?

The Peak-End Rule creates lasting impressions by designing a memorable peak moment and a strong ending in your flow. Users recall experiences based on their most intense moment and how they ended, so this Skill helps you craft both to boost retention and satisfaction across onboarding, checkout, and form completion.

How can I use progress indicators to prevent mid-flow disengagement?

The Goal-Gradient Effect shows users visible progress toward completion, which increases motivation to finish. This Skill applies that principle to identify where progress indicators are missing and recommends placement and design to sustain momentum through form completion and checkout flows.

What's the difference between designing for peak moments versus overall experience?

Most flows focus on smoothness throughout, but the Peak-End Rule prioritizes the most intense or satisfying moment and the final impression. This Skill balances both by applying multiple UX laws—Peak-End, Goal-Gradient, and Zeigarnik—so you improve memory, motivation, and return visits simultaneously.

How does the Zeigarnik Effect encourage users to return to incomplete flows?

The Zeigarnik Effect leverages unfinished states to create psychological tension that prompts return visits. This Skill recommends where to apply incomplete states—like unfinished form sections or paused onboarding—so users feel compelled to complete the journey and improve overall retention.
